00:08:59 This video discusses the dangers of radiation exposure and explores ways to make an infinity snap safer, including reducing the time and distance of exposure to decrease radiation intake.

🔑 The video discusses the death of a scientist due to exposure to radiation from a critical core.

🔑 The Infinity Gauntlet in the movie could release radiation and cause a flash of light.

🔑 To make an infinity snap safer, one can reduce the time of exposure, increase the distance from the Infinity Gauntlet, and use radiation protection.

00:11:14 Iron Man tried to protect himself from the radiation of the snap by moving the Infinity Gauntlet further away and using shielding. However, he was unable to find a perfect solution and ultimately sacrificed himself to save the universe.

🔍 Increasing the distance from the Infinity Gauntlet reduces the intensity of radiation.

🛡️ Shielding is necessary to protect against radiation, but gamma rays require special materials like lead or water.
